(Minghui.org) Falun Gong practitioners in 45 countries submitted another list of Chinese Communist Party (CCP) officials who participated in the persecution of Falun Gong in July 2025, 26 years after the CCP ordered the persecution. The practitioners demand their governments hold the perpetrators accountable, bar them and/or their family members from entry and freeze their assets.
These 45 countries include The Five Eyes: (United States, Canada, United Kingdom, Australia, New Zealand), all 27 countries in the European Union (EU) and 13 countries on other continents. The EU countries are Germany, France, Italy, Spain, Netherlands, Poland, Sweden, Belgium, Ireland, Austria, Denmark, Romania, Czechia, Finland, Portugal, Greece, Hungary, Slovakia, Bulgaria, Luxembourg, Croatia, Lithuania, Slovenia, Latvia, Estonia, Cyprus, and Malta. The remaining 13 countries are located in Asia, Europe, and the Americas: Japan, South Korea, Indonesia, Switzerland, Norway, Liechtenstein, Israel, Mexico, Argentina, Colombia, Chile, the Dominican Republic, and Paraguay.
According to a report published by the World Organization to Investigate the Persecution of Falun Gong (WOIPFG), the CCP highlighted a goal in a May 2024 meeting organized by the Ministry of Public Security, “Pay special attention to the cooperation between Falun Gong and Western politicians to sanction high-level Chinese leaders. Stop such behavior at all costs.”
Among the perpetrators listed was Li Jing, first-level inspector of the Prison Administration Bureau of the Ministry of Justice.
Full Name of Perpetrator: Li (last name) Jing (first name) (李静)Gender: FemaleCountry: ChinaDate of Birth: UnknownPlace of Birth: Unknown
Prior to 2016 – 2016: director of the Penal Execution Department of the Prison Administration Bureau of the Ministry of Justice
2017 – 2023: deputy director of the Prison Administration Bureau of the Ministry of Justice
2023 – Present: first-level inspector of the Prison Administration Bureau of the Ministry of Justice
During her tenure in the Prison Administration Bureau of the Ministry of Justice and especially after she became the deputy director of the Prison Administration Bureau, Li Jing actively participated in the CCP’s systematic persecution policy that targets Falun Gong. The national prison system not only continued the unlawful detention of Falun Gong practitioners, but also intensified the “transformation rate” assessment mechanism, explicitly designating the forced renunciation of belief by Falun Gong practitioners as a political task for prisons at all levels.
To achieve a certain “transformation rate,” prisons use various torture methods such as electric shocks, hanging up by the wrists, sleep deprivation, force-feeding, beatings, brainwashing, and involuntary drug administration. The inmates were also instigated to take the lead in torturing practitioners. Those who did had their sentences reduced.
Between 2017 and 2023, at least 145 Falun Gong practitioners passed away due to torture in prison, including those who died in prison and those who died shortly after their release.
The 145 practitioners came from seventeen provinces, two autonomous regions, and four municipalities. Liaoning Province had the most cases of 33 (23.8%), followed by 20 cases in Heilongjiang Province, 14 cases in Jilin Province and 10 cases in Hebei Province.
The remaining 19 regions had single-digit cases: Sichuan Province (8 cases), Henan Province (7 cases), Shandong Province (6 cases), Hubei Province (6 cases), Yunnan Province (5 cases), Jiangsu Province (5 cases), Gansu Province (4 cases), Hunan Province (4 cases), Tianjin (4 cases), Zhejiang Province (3 cases), Chongqing (3 cases), Anhui Province (3 cases), Shanxi Province (3 cases),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region (2 cases), Inner Mongolia Autonomous Region (1 case), Guizhou Province (1 case), Shaanxi Province (1 case), Beijing (1 case), and Shanghai (1 case).

Case 1. Liaoning Man Passed Away Three Weeks After Being Released from Prison
Mr. Lu Yuanfeng, from Shenyang City, Liaoning Province, was sentenced to three years in prison. In early November 2016, the guards at Benxi Prison took Mr. Lu to the workshop warehouse and instructed inmates to hold him down. They verbally abused him while kicking him and shocking him with three electric batons. The continuous electric shocks went on for more than forty minutes. Mr. Lu rolled around due to the pain. His head, neck, hands, ankles, and other areas of his body were severely burned.
By the time he was released on November 18, 2017, he changed drastically—he went from being strong and healthy to being very weak and sick. His eyes were dull, his speech was slurred, and he had a stroke. His femoral head was broken and displaced, and he was paralyzed. He died on December 9, 2017, just 21 days after returning home. He was 63.
Case 2. Liaoning Teacher Tortured to Death in Liaoning Province Women’s Prison
Ms. Sun Min, a teacher in Anshan City, Liaoning Province, was tortured to death in Liaoning Women’s Prison on March 8, 2018, while serving a seven-year term. She was 50 years old. Her father said he was finally allowed to visit her in prison on February 7, 2018, nearly two years after she was arrested on June 28, 2016. She was carried to the visitation room on someone’s back. She could no longer walk as a result of torture. One month later on March 8, the prison notified her father that Ms. Sun was transferred to the Liaoning Province Prison Management Bureau General Hospital. When he arrived at the hospital at 12:50 p.m. that day, he was told that she was dead.
Case 3. Liaoning Woman Dies 14 Days after Being Sent to Prison
Ms. Li Yanqiu, of Jinzhou City, Liaoning Province, was arrested on December 14, 2018, while she distributed Falun Gong informational calendars. Her computer, Falun Gong books, and other personal belongings were confiscated. She was held in Jinzhou City Women's Detention Center. On the morning of January 21, 2019, while Ms. Li was very weak and couldn’t talk clearly, the Taihe District Court tried her secretly in the detention center and sentenced her to five years in prison. She was transferred to Liaoning Provincial Women’s Prison on February 19, 2019. On March 4, on her 14th day in that prison, she was tortured to death at the age of 52.
Case 4: 65-Year-Old Woman Dies 17 Months Into Her Prison Term
Ms. Zhang Yaqin, of Xiangtan City, Hunan Province, was arrested on December 30, 2018, for talking to people about Falun Gong at a farmer’s market. She was later sentenced to three years. She was admitted to the Hunan Province Women’s Prison on August 13, 2019, and held in the High Security Division. She was subjected to intensive brainwashing aimed at forcing her to renounce Falun Gong. Her family was not allowed to visit her during that time. She developed high blood pressure and became emaciated as a result of the torture. She passed away in prison on December 12, 2020, at the age of 65.
It’s been reported that, since 2017, all Falun Gong practitioners newly admitted to the prison have to spend the first two months in the High-Security Division and be subjected to brainwashing and coercion designed to force them to give up Falun Gong.
They are made to stand for long hours each day and not allowed to use the restroom. When they end up relieving themselves in their pants, the guards only allow them to wash their pants quickly but not their bodies. They also force practitioners to wear the soiled pants, even in the winter. Their lower bodies become infected and the wounds fester.
A guard once instigated an inmate to torture Falun Gong practitioners this way: “We’ll let them eat but not use the restroom.”
Case 5: Hubei Woman Dies 13 Days After Being Admitted to Prison
Ms. Hu Hanjiao of Hanchuan City, Hubei Province, passed away 13 days after being admitted to prison to serve a four-year term. Ms. Hu was arrested on March 15, 2021, and sentenced on June 16, 2021, for talking to people about Falun Gong.
At 8 p.m. on November 9, 2021, 13 days after she was transferred to the Hubei Province Women’s Prison, a guard called Ms. Hu’s husband and said that she had a disease and died at the hospital. The authorities didn’t allow her husband to see her body or her medical record. They also pressured him to dismiss the lawyer he hired to seek justice for Ms. Hu and ordered him to not discuss her death with local Falun Gong practitioners.
Case 6: Retired Colonel Dies in Prison, Family Suspects Foul Play
Mr. Gong Piqi was the former Deputy Chief of Staff of the Reserve Antiaircraft Artillery Division in Shandong Province. Under instructions from Qingdao Political and Legal Affairs Committee (PLAC), 610 Office, and the Shibei Domestic Security Bureau, the Shibei Procuratorate indicted him and the Shibei Court sentenced him to seven and a half years on July 20, 2018. He was ordered to serve time in Shandong Prison in Jinan.
He died in prison on April 12, 2021. He was 66. His family saw wounds on his head, which was also wet and swollen. Blood dripped from his ears.
Shandong Prison is notorious for torturing Falun Gong practitioners. Many practitioners were killed, disabled, and injured there. Instigated by the guards to torture practitioners, some inmates say, “We were told not to kill you, but to make your life a living hell – so you would rather die than live.”
Case 7: 30-Year-Old Former Radio Host Beaten to Death in Prison
Mr. Pang Xun, a former host for the Sichuan Province People’s Radio Station, was tortured to death on December 2, 2022, just six months after he was admitted to Jiazhou Prison, Sichuan Province, to serve a five-year term because he practiced Falun Gong. He was 30.
According to another Falun Gong practitioner who was also detained in Jiazhou Prison, Mr. Pang was subjected to many rounds of torture, including being handcuffed and shackled, shocked with electric batons, sprayed with spicy water, force-fed, and forced to stand under the scorching sun for long hours. The scars from electric shocks on his head were still visible months later.
When they saw that torture couldn’t shake Mr. Pang’s will, the guards and inmates tortured him for eleven days straight, eventually killing him. They sprayed spicy water into his nostrils, eyes and ears. He couldn’t open his eyes as a result. At night, the guards restrained him in the metal interrogation chair and didn’t give him a blankets.
Mr. Pang held a hunger strike to protest and the guards continued to shock him with electric batons, until he was on the verge of death. Despite the temperature drop, the guards still left him in the metal interrogation chair in thin clothes, and did not give him a blanket.
When Mr. Pang passed away around 2 a.m. on December 2, the guards ordered the inmates to call an ambulance. They claimed they were still trying to resuscitate him.
Case 8: Family Suspects Foul Play in 72-year-old Man’s Sudden Death in Jidong Prison
Mr. Wang Jian, a resident of Zunhua City, Hebei Province, was arrested at home on July 6, 2019, and later sentenced to seven years in prison and fined 5,000 yuan. He appeared to be fine and in good spirits when his family visited him on March 19, 2023. However, the family received a surprise phone call from the prison on April 3, 2023, and were told he died. He was 72 years old.
Mr. Wang had large areas of deep bruises around his ears and on his back, as well as some bruises on the back of his right hand. There was a circular mark on his chest and some scratches on his back. When the coroner turned his body over, fluid came out of his left ear.
The prison claimed that Mr. Wang died suddenly of a disease, but did not specify which disease. To the family, the bruises on Mr. Wang’s head and back seemed unusual, and not caused by a normal disease. They asked if they were caused by torture or other mistreatment that the prison was trying to hide.
Case 9: 75-Year-Old Retired Teacher Dies in Heilongjiang Province Women’s Prison
Ms. Mou Yongxia, a 75-year-old retired teacher in Daqing City, Heilongjiang Province, died from ongoing abuse at the Heilongjiang Province Women’s Prison on July 13, 2023. The guards cremated Ms. Mou’s body before they notified her family that she died.
Ms. Mou was arrested in September 2019 and sentenced to a six-year prison term by the Ranghulu District Court in May 2020. Guards at the Heilongjiang Province Women’s Prison instigated the inmates to beat and verbally abuse her. Years of torture and abuse took a toll on her health and she could barely move.
When Ms. Mou suffered bowel incontinence in August 2022, an inmate beat her and poured cold water on her. She also subsequently suffered a mental disorder, yet the guards and other inmates continued to routinely beat her.
In late December 2022, a prisoner complained that Ms. Mou walked too slowly and roughly pushed her from behind. Ms. Mou fell to the ground resulting in bruises to her face. That night she developed frequent urination, and she had to get up more than ten times every night. The inmates assigned to watch her often verbally abused her and beat her because of this.
Ms. Mou often woke up in the middle of night screaming because of the ongoing abuse. It was so loud that inmates in the other cells could hear her. She was disoriented and could not even recognize other Falun Gong practitioners who were staying in the same cell with her.
Her son demanded that the prison authorities release Ms. Mou on medical parole, but his requests were repeatedly denied.
